Bolsonaro files suit at Supreme Court to bar restrictions imposed by governors

RIO DE JANEIRO, BRAZIL - On Thursday, May 27, President Jair Bolsonaro asked the Federal Supreme Court (STF) to bar restrictions imposed by the governors of Rio Grande do Norte, Pernambuco and Paraná to prevent the spread of Covid-19 in those states.

Bolsonaro has been a harsh critic of these state and municipal initiatives, universally known as among the most efficient measures to contain the pandemic.

He calls these determinations a lockdown, although he is technically incorrect.
